"quickstart.exe" Startup Program on Windows 8
What is the startup program "quickstart.exe" on my Windows 8 computer?

"quickstart.exe" is a startup program
associated with OpenOffice software.
You will see "quickstart.exe" listed on the Startup tab of Task Manager screen as:
Name: quickstart.exe Publisher: Command: C:\Program Files (x86)\OpenOffice.org 3\program\quickstart.exe Location:
Program file information about "quickstart.exe":
File name: quickstart.exe File path: C:\Program Files (x86)\OpenOffice.org 3\program\quickstart.exe File size: 1195008 bytes Last modified time: 5/20/2010 12:14:28 PM File description: File version: Company name:
"quickstart.exe" is most likely installed as part of OpenOffice software installation.
It is recommended to disable "quickstart.exe" as a startup program. You don't need it to run OpenOffice.
